New team members should note that the experiment framework, Splitgrove, now caps per-user price deltas and logs every assignment to the audit stream, so historical dashboards before this release are not directly comparable. These changes apply to all regions except the Vantorre pilot. The updated experiment configuration is reproduced below.

config for yajep-tafof:
[rusath]
team = julmir
access_code = ac_fe37fd
host = rusath.novactech.test
port = 8000
owner = pelmir.weneth
peer = oliwyn.olvarqdyn.internal

Account Recovery — Pagewright Static Builds

If a customer loses access to their Pagewright dashboard, incremental rebuilds of their static site will continue from the last known-good deploy, so no content is lost during recovery. Confirm the customer's last rebuild timestamp in the Orlin console, then initiate the recovery flow from the admin panel. Do not trigger a full rebuild until access is restored. Unlocking the recovery flow requires the passphrase below.

recovery phrase for yadup-taguf: wenael-quenox-kelix

/*
 * Blue-green deploy constants for the Marrowpay billing worker.
 * The green pool must drain in-flight invoice batches fully before
 * traffic cutover; an early flip caused double-charges in the past.
 * Drain timeouts and health-probe counts below were chosen after the
 * Q3 load tests. Change them only together, and in this order. */

tuning constants:
QUOTAS = {
    "druwyn": 5,
    "holix": 5,
    "zorath": 5,
    "holwyn": 10,
}

Subject: Cron migration to Loomworks — ready for review

Hi all,

The first batch of nightly cron jobs (billing rollup, cache warmers, digest mailer) has been ported to the Loomworks workflow engine. Schedules and retry semantics match the old crontab; diffs are in the migration branch. Please review the retry policies especially. Everything was validated against the staging build noted below.

pipeline stamp: htk31_f769b577b3028a4e9958e5bb8d1259a